Israel attacks Iran's South Pars gas field again

Israel attacks Iran's South Pars gas field again

France 24

Israeli airstrikes hit two petrochemical plants in Iran's South Pars gas field complex.  It's the second time Israel has targeted the key energy complex since the war started.  The previous attack on March 18 triggered retaliatory strikes by Iran on energy infrastructure across the region. Follow live: Artemis II's final lunar flyby

Follow live: Artemis II's final lunar flyby

France 24

Artemis II set a new distance record on Monday, breaking the previous record set by the Apollo 13 mission, for the farthest spaceflight from Earth. During the lunar flyby, which will last for several hours, the Artemis II crew will study specific lunar sites and phenomena as part of a 10-goal plan by NASA.
